FIM Motul Superbike & Supersport World Championships

2016 Calendar, updated 01 April

The 2016 FIM Motul Superbike & Supersport World Championships event, originally scheduled to take place at the Autodromo Nazionale Monza (ITA) on 24 July, is cancelled. A replacement venue for this event is still being considered. Confirmation of the location and the date of the replacement will be provided before the 1st of May. The provisional 2016 calendar is as follows:

2016 Motul FIM Superbike World Championship

26-28 February, Phillip Island, Australia

11-13 March, Chang International Circuit, Thailand

1-3 April, Motorland Aragon, Spain

15-17 April, TT Circuit Assen, Netherlands

29-1 May, Autodromo Internazionale Enzo e Dino Ferrari di Imola, Italy

13-15 May, Sepang International Circuit, Malaysia

27-29 May, Donington Park, UK

17-19 June, Misano World Circuit ‘Marco Simoncelli,’ San Marino

8-10 July, Mazda Raceway Laguna Seca, Monterey, California, USA

TBA*

16-18 September, Lausitzring, Germany

30-2 October, Circuit de Nevers Magny-Cours, France

14-16 October, Circuito de Jerez, Spain**

28-30 October, Losail International Circuit, Qatar

*(TBA) To be announced

**(STC) Subject to contract
